Decentralized VPNs: Redefining Secure Internet Access
The internet landscape is dynamically changing, and with it, the need for robust security measures. Enter decentralized VPNs, a groundbreaking innovation that promises to reshape the way we browse online. Unlike traditional centralized VPNs, which rely on a single server controlled by a provider, decentralized VPNs leverage a network of users to encrypt and route your internet traffic. This structure offers several benefits. First and foremost, it enhances security by eliminating the single point of failure that centralized VPNs present. By distributing your data across multiple nodes, decentralized VPNs make it significantly harder for cybercriminals to intercept or compromise your information.
Moreover, decentralized VPNs often boast greater transparency. Because the network is open-source, users can audit the code and verify its functionality. This level of openness fosters trust and confidence in the system.

Turn Off Your iPhone's VPN Connection
Want stop your iPhone's VPN connection? It's easy peasy. First, open the Settings app on your device. Then, scroll down and tap the "VPN" choice. Tap on that to view the VPN connections list. Next, select the VPN connection you want to turn off. Finally, tap the toggle next to the connection name to gray it out
